Air Fryer Tortilla Chips Recipe

Introduction

Air fryer tortilla chips are a quick and easy snack that’s crispy, flavorful, and much healthier than store-bought versions. Using simple ingredients and your air fryer, you can make fresh chips in no time perfect for dipping or munching on their own.

Ingredients

  • 4 yellow corn tortillas
  • Coarse salt, to taste
  • Cooking spray (avocado or olive oil)

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Slice the tortillas into 6 wedges each, similar to cutting a small tortilla pizza. You will have 24 chips total.
  2. Step 2: Place as many tortilla wedges as possible in a single layer in your air fryer basket without overlapping. Depending on your air fryer’s size, this is usually about 9 pieces.
  3. Step 3: Lightly spray the tortilla pieces with cooking oil and sprinkle coarse salt over them to taste.
  4. Step 4: Preheat your air fryer for 1 to 2 minutes to ensure even cooking and crispiness.
  5. Step 5: Cook the chips at 300°F (150°C) for 8 minutes or until they are crisp and just golden at the edges. Repeat in batches until all chips are done. Let cool slightly before enjoying.

Tips & Variations

  • For extra flavor, sprinkle with chili powder, garlic powder, or a squeeze of lime before air frying.
  • If you prefer thicker chips, cut tortillas into fewer wedges for a bigger, heartier chip.
  • Use corn or flour tortillas based on your preference, but corn gives the classic chip texture.

Storage

Store leftover chips in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. To re-crisp, warm them in the air fryer at 300°F for 2-3 minutes before serving.

FAQs

Can I use flour tortillas instead of corn?

Yes, flour tortillas can be used and will yield softer, less crispy chips. Corn tortillas are preferred for a traditional crunch.

Do I need to flip the chips during air frying?

No flipping is necessary since the air fryer circulates hot air evenly, but feel free to check halfway if you prefer even crispiness on both sides.
